Building automation, on the other hand, refers to the use of technology to control and monitor a building’s systems, such as heating, ventilation, air conditioning, lighting, and security By automating these systems, businesses can reduce energy costs, improve occupant comfort, and enhance overall building performance This not only benefits the organization financially but also contributes to sustainability efforts by reducing carbon emissions.

When scheduling and building automation systems are integrated, businesses can achieve even greater efficiency gains For example, by syncing the building’s heating and cooling systems with the schedule of occupancy, organizations can avoid wasting energy on empty spaces Similarly, automating lighting systems based on occupancy sensors can further reduce energy consumption and improve employee comfort.

Moreover, scheduling and building automation systems can enhance safety and security within a building By integrating access control systems with scheduling software, businesses can restrict access to certain areas at specific times, reducing the risk of unauthorized entry Similarly, automated lighting and security systems can deter intruders and provide a safer working environment for employees.
